def msg_no_analysis_helper(rec_list, corrected_nick, nick, conn_comp_list,conversations,today_conversation): for receiver in rec_list: if(receiver == nick): if(corrected_nick != nick): nick_receiver = '' nick_receiver = util.get_nick_sen_rec(config.MAX_EXPECTED_DIFF_NICKS, nick, conn_comp_list, nick_receiver) if DAY_BY_DAY_ANALYSIS: today_conversation = util.extend_conversation_list(nick_sender, nick_receiver, today_conversation) else: conversations = util.extend_conversation_list(nick_sender, nick_receiver, conversations)
def test_extend_conversation_list(self): conversations = [[0] for i in range(config.MAX_EXPECTED_DIFF_NICKS)] util.extend_conversation_list("krishna", "rohan", conversations) util.extend_conversation_list("krishna", "rohan", conversations) util.extend_conversation_list("rohan", "rohit", conversations) self.assertListEqual(conversations[0:2], [[2, "krishna", "rohan"], [1, "rohan", "rohit"]])